Country music star Toby Keith announced on Sunday that he was being treated for stomach cancer last fall.
The singer, who sells a lot of platinum, said on Twitter that he had undergone surgery and received chemotherapy and radiation in the past six months.
“Everything’s fine so far,” said Oklahoma-born Keith, who turns 61 on July 8. “I need time to breathe, recover and relax.
“I look forward to spending this time with my family. But I will see the fans soon. I can not wait.”

The state of Keith’s performances for the rest of this year was not immediately clear. His next performance is scheduled for June 17 in Wheaton, Illinois, according to his website. Following Keith’s announcement, the Ohio State Fair announced that his July 28 concert in Columbus, Ohio, had been canceled.
Keith’s Elaine Shock said in an email Sunday night that some tour dates would be canceled, “but I’m not sure how many at the moment.”
The Keith Foundation has been supporting children with cancer since 2006.
